Hispanics are one minority Americans constantly categorize and even degrade with derogatory names. Julia Alvarez shows the stereotypes of Hispanic men and women in her narrative How the Garcia Girls Lost Their Accents. First, Alvarez presents the stereotypes given to Hispanic males.
